It seems the Seamoth is (one of) the causes of super slow frame rates in September release. If the 'moth was move just one key-click, the screen would go into slo-mo - then recover if you were totally still.
I built a new 'moth, and it worked fine - no slo-mo - but didn't want the double Seamoth beacons - SO - I parked the bad 'moth by some cargo boxes, and used the Propulsion Cannon to throw them at it... In a short while it will explode into parts - then they disappear!
